The settings file is OK.

The logs show that the gnome-session process is terminated right after
being started. This might be caused either by early termination of the
gdm-simple-greeter process, or by the gdm-simple-slave process deciding
to kill gnome-session for a reason or another.

Either way I don’t have enough information to debug the problem, so I’ll
leave you (or an alpha porter) at debugging what happens.
